Technical Specifications
Side-by-side comparison of Xeon 6517P and Xeon 6736P

Xeon 6517P
The Xeon 6517P is manufactured by Intel. It was released in 24 February 2025 (less than a year ago). It is based on the Granite Rapids (2024−2025) architecture. It features 16 cores and 32 threads. Base frequency is 3.2 GHz, with boost up to 4.2 GHz. L3 cache: 72 MB (total). L2 cache: 2 MB (per core). Built on Intel 3 nm process technology. Socket: LGA4710. Thermal design power (TDP): 190 Watt. Memory support: DDR5(6400MT/s). Passmark benchmark score: 48,810 points. Launch price was $1,195.

Xeon 6736P
The Xeon 6736P is manufactured by Intel. It was released in 24 February 2025 (less than a year ago). It is based on the Granite Rapids (2024−2025) architecture. It features 36 cores and 72 threads. Base frequency is 2 GHz, with boost up to 4.1 GHz. L3 cache: 144 MB (total). L2 cache: 2 MB (per core). Built on Intel 3 nm process technology. Socket: LGA4710. Thermal design power (TDP): 205 Watt. Memory support: DDR5(6400MT/s). Passmark benchmark score: 50,072 points. Launch price was $3,351.
Processing Power
The Xeon 6517P packs 16 cores / 32 threads, while the Xeon 6736P offers 36 cores / 72 threads — the Xeon 6736P has 20 more cores. Boost clocks reach 4.2 GHz on the Xeon 6517P versus 4.1 GHz on the Xeon 6736P — a 2.4% clock advantage for the Xeon 6517P (base: 3.2 GHz vs 2 GHz). Both are built on the Granite Rapids (2024−2025) architecture using a Intel 3 nm process. In PassMark, the Xeon 6517P scores 48,810 against the Xeon 6736P's 50,072 — a 2.6% lead for the Xeon 6736P. L3 cache: 72 MB (total) on the Xeon 6517P vs 144 MB (total) on the Xeon 6736P.

Memory & Platform
Both processors use the LGA4710 socket with PCIe 5.0. Both support up to 6400 memory speed. Both support up to 4096 of RAM. Both feature 8-channel memory with ECC support. Both provide 88 PCIe lanes. Chipset compatibility: Granite Rapids-SP (Xeon 6517P) and Granite Rapids-SP (Xeon 6736P).

Advanced Features
Neither processor supports overclocking. Both support AVX-512 instructions, benefiting scientific computing, AI inference, and encryption workloads. Both support VT-x, VT-d virtualization. Direct competitor: Xeon 6517P rivals EPYC 9554; Xeon 6736P rivals EPYC 9684X.

Value Analysis
The Xeon 6517P launched at $1195 MSRP, while the Xeon 6736P debuted at $3351. At current prices ($1195 vs $3351), the Xeon 6517P is $2156 cheaper. In terms of value (PassMark points per dollar), the Xeon 6517P delivers 40.8 pts/$ vs 14.9 pts/$ for the Xeon 6736P — making the Xeon 6517P the 92.9% better value option.
